Find the two solutions of x^2+9=5.

Answer:

x=2i, x=-2i

Step-by-step explanation:

x^2+9=5

x^2+9-9=5-9

simplify:

x^2=-4

x=root -4, x=-root-4

SImplify:

root 4=2

=2i and -2i
